Transaction e4583ab3a40bb1a43ffd3ce6d286392d4bab717fe2c7b6096b7872f3ffe59762
1 Input
1 Output
-
e4583ab3a40bb1a43ffd3ce6d286392d4bab717fe2c7b6096b7872f3ffe59762:0
- value
- 43048699
- script pubkey
- OP_0 OP_PUSHBYTES_20 3be577fbd36c09b3a0047254face0ebb224c7f7a
- address
- bc1q80jh077ndsym8gqywf204nswhv3yclm6yn64fe